Replacing 'ReadStream on: smth' by 'smth readStream' is not mandatory.
However, it makes the code simpler to read, avoids a direct class
reference and allows different implementation of #readStream depending
on the kind of collection it is sent to. I do not think anyone is
against that as soon as I apply the automatic refactoring carefully. I
did that and didn't see any place where the RB did a bad job. It even
detected that SequenceableCollection>>readStream should not be changed
to avoid infinite recursion.
